Husband, Parent, Business Entrepreneur, Saint

On 18th December 2025, Pope Leo authorised the Dicastery for the Causes of Saints to publish the decree recognising a miracle attributed to the intercession of the Venerable Servant of God Enrico Ernesto Shaw, lay faithful and father of a family.

Allow God to order steps in the New Year

How you ever noticed how clearly the Gospel focuses on change? The Bible is all about a change from the old covenant to the new covenant. Jesus tells his disciples about a change that begins with a baptism of fire. He works his first miracle by changing water into wine. The Sermon on the Mount tells us to change from the old law to the new law, where we love our enemies and overcome evil with an abundance of good deeds.
